Staying Cool: A Florida Homeowner's Guide to the Best Air Conditioner Brands

Florida's relentless heat and humidity demand a reliable and efficient air conditioning system. Choosing the right brand and model can significantly impact your comfort levels, energy bills, and overall property value. This comprehensive guide explores the top air conditioner brands suitable for Florida homes, comparing their features, performance, and cost to help you make an informed decision.

Understanding Key AC Terminology

Before diving into specific brands, it's crucial to understand the terminology used to assess AC performance:

  • S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io): Measures cooling efficiency. Higher SEER ratings indicate greater energy savings. Look for a SEER rating of at least 15 for optimal energy efficiency in Florida.
  • AFUE (Annual Fuel Utilization Efficiency): Primarily relevant for furnaces, not air conditioners. It measures the heating efficiency of a furnace.
  • HSPF (Heating Seasonal Performance Factor): Measures the heating efficiency of heat pumps. Not directly relevant to standalone AC units.
  • BTU (British Thermal Units): Measures the cooling capacity of an air conditioner. The appropriate BTU rating depends on the size of your home and other factors like insulation and window placement.

Top Air Conditioner Brands for Florida Homes

We've evaluated several leading AC brands based on their performance in hot and humid climates like Florida's. Here's a breakdown of the top contenders:

Trane

Trane is renowned for its durability and reliability. Their units are built to withstand harsh conditions and offer consistent performance.

Pros:

  • Exceptional durability and longevity
  • Wide range of models to suit various needs and budgets
  • Advanced features like the Trane Link system for smart home integration

Cons:

  • Generally higher upfront cost compared to some other brands
  • Repair costs can be higher due to specialized components

Key Features & Models:

  • Trane XV20i: High-efficiency variable-speed unit with a SEER rating up to 20.
  • Trane XR16: A more budget-friendly option with a SEER rating up to 17.
  • Climatuff compressors known for their reliability.

Pricing:

Expect to pay a premium for Trane units, typically ranging from $4,000 to $8,000+ for installation, depending on the model and size.

Carrier

Carrier is another leading brand known for its innovation and energy-efficient air conditioners. They offer a wide selection of models with advanced features.

Pros:

  • High energy efficiency, helping to lower utility bills
  • Innovative features like Infinity System Control for zoning and smart home integration
  • Relatively quiet operation

Cons:

  • Can be more expensive than some competing brands
  • Some models require specialized technicians for repairs

Key Features & Models:

  • Carrier Infinity 26: Top-of-the-line model with a SEER rating up to 26.
  • Carrier Performance 16: A mid-range option offering good efficiency and performance.
  • Greenspeed Intelligence for variable-speed operation and optimal comfort.

Pricing:

Carrier AC units typically range from $3,500 to $7,500+ installed, depending on the model and system complexity.

Rheem

Rheem offers a balance of affordability and reliability, making them a popular choice for homeowners on a budget.

Pros:

  • More affordable than Trane or Carrier
  • Good selection of models with decent energy efficiency
  • Easy to find parts and service

Cons:

  • May not be as durable as higher-end brands
  • Fewer advanced features compared to premium models

Key Features & Models:

  • Rheem Prestige Series: High-efficiency models with SEER ratings up to 20.
  • Rheem Classic Series: More affordable options with SEER ratings around 14-16.
  • EcoNet smart home integration.

Pricing:

Rheem air conditioners typically cost between $3,000 and $6,000 installed.

Goodman

Goodman is known for offering the lowest prices on the market. This can be appealing for those with tight budgets, but it's important to consider potential trade-offs in terms of longevity and features.

Pros:

  • Lowest upfront cost
  • Simple design for easy repairs

Cons:

  • May not be as energy-efficient as other brands
  • Potentially shorter lifespan compared to premium brands
  • Basic features

Key Features & Models:

  • Goodman GSX16: A popular model offering a SEER rating of up to 16.
  • Goodman GSX14: An entry-level option with a lower SEER rating.

Pricing:

Goodman AC units typically range from $2,500 to $5,000 installed.

Lennox

Lennox positions itself as a provider of premium, high-efficiency air conditioners, often incorporating innovative technology and design. They are known for quiet operation and advanced air purification features.

Pros:

  • Extremely high SEER ratings available on some models
  • Quiet operation
  • Advanced air purification options

Cons:

  • Generally higher upfront cost
  • Parts and service can be more expensive than some other brands

Key Features & Models:

  • Lennox XC25: Ultra-high efficiency with SEER ratings up to 26
  • Lennox SL280V: Variable speed furnace
  • iComfort smart thermostat compatibility

Pricing:

Lennox units range from $4,500 - $9,000+ installed.

Choosing the Right Size AC Unit

Selecting the correct size air conditioner is crucial for optimal performance and energy efficiency. An undersized unit will struggle to cool your home, while an oversized unit will cycle on and off frequently, leading to wasted energy and reduced dehumidification. Consult with an HVAC professional to determine the appropriate BTU rating for your home based on factors such as square footage, insulation, window size and orientation, and local climate conditions. A Manual J load calculation is recommended for accurate sizing.

Warranty Considerations

A solid warranty provides peace of mind and protects your investment. Pay close attention to the warranty terms and conditions offered by each brand. Common warranty types include:

  • Compressor warranty: Typically covers the compressor for 5-10 years or longer.
  • Parts warranty: Covers other components of the AC unit for a specified period.
  • Labor warranty: Covers the cost of labor for repairs. Some manufacturers offer extended labor warranties.

Ensure that the warranty is registered properly after installation to ensure full coverage.

Maintenance Tips for Florida's Climate

Regular maintenance is essential to keep your AC unit running efficiently and extend its lifespan. Consider these tips:

  • Change air filters regularly: Dirty air filters restrict airflow and reduce efficiency. Replace them every 1-3 months, or more frequently if you have pets or allergies.
  • Clean the outdoor unit: Remove debris such as leaves, grass clippings, and dirt from around the outdoor unit.
  • Schedule annual professional maintenance: A qualified HVAC technician can inspect and clean the unit, check refrigerant levels, and identify potential problems before they become major issues.
  • Consider a service contract: Many HVAC companies offer service contracts that provide regular maintenance and priority service.
